Core Skills Analysis
Playing with Legos
- Developed fine motor skills through manipulating small Lego pieces.
- Enhanced creativity by building unique structures and designs.
- Improved problem-solving skills by figuring out how to connect different Lego pieces.
- Learned basic principles of geometry and engineering by creating stable structures.
Tips
Engaging in activities like playing with Legos can greatly benefit a child's cognitive development. To further enhance the learning experience, it would be beneficial to introduce themed challenges or prompts to encourage more structured and goal-oriented building. Additionally, incorporating storytelling elements into the Lego play can help foster language development and enhance imaginative thinking.
